blog

Азы HTML и CSS для начинающих

Азы HTML и CSS для начинающих

Создание веб-страниц стартует с освоения двух основных инструментов. HTML отвечает за построение и контент веб-страниц. CSS управляет зрительным оформлением компонентов.

Специалисты применяют HTML для вставки текста, графики, ссылок и других компонентов. CSS позволяет устанавливать оттенки, гарнитуры, размеры и размещение блоков. Эти языки работают совместно и дополняются друг друга.

Овладение 7ка казино предоставляет дорогу к специальности веб-разработчика. Понимание базовых правил способствует создавать действующие и привлекательные сайты. Начинающие профессионалы могут скоро освоить прикладные навыки и внедрить их в живых задачах.

Что такое HTML и зачем он необходим веб-ресурсу

HTML интерпретируется как HyperText Markup Language. Язык разметки задаёт организацию веб-документов и упорядочивает наполнение страниц. Браузеры читают HTML-код и показывают контент в ясном для пользователей виде.

Каждый компонент страницы определяется особыми инструкциями. Титулы, параграфы, перечни, таблицы и формы формируются с посредством элементов. Элементы представляют собой команды, помещённые в угловые скобки. Браузер читает эти инструкции и формирует зрительное представление содержимого.

Без HTML нельзя создать 7К казино любого типа. Язык разметки является основой для всех сайтов. Поисковые системы исследуют HTML-структуру для индексации веб-страниц. Корректная структура усиливает позиции сайта в выдаче запроса.

HTML непрерывно эволюционирует и обретает свежие опции. Современная редакция HTML5 обеспечивает видео, аудио и интерактивные элементы. Разработчики могут встраивать мультимедийный контент без внешних расширений. Смысловые метки способствуют казино 7к лучше понимать роль разнообразных контейнеров страницы.

Базовые элементы и структура веб-страницы

Любой HTML-документ обладает чёткую иерархическую организацию. Основной элемент html включает всё наполнение страницы. Внутри находятся два главных блока: head и body.

Блок head содержит служебную информацию о странице. Здесь указывается название страницы, присоединяются стили и скрипты. Пользователи не наблюдают содержимое этого блока напрямую. Блок body содержит весь отображаемый содержимое.

Для организации материала задействуются разнообразные элементы:

  • h1-h6 создают заголовки разнообразных уровней
  • p оформляет текстовые параграфы
  • a формирует гиперссылки на иные страницы
  • img добавляет графику в документ
  • ul и ol генерируют маркерные и нумерованные перечни
  • table структурирует данные в табличном виде

Семантические метки превращают структуру более читаемой. Элемент header обозначает заголовок сайта. Тег nav собирает навигационные гиперссылки. Элемент main включает основное контент страницы. Footer размещается в нижней зоне и содержит контактную информацию.

Корректная архитектура файла важна для доступности. Приложения чтения с экрана применяют 7k casino для навигации по веб-странице. Структурированная структура элементов облегчает усвоение сведений всеми категориями пользователей. Корректный код работает корректно во всех современных обозревателях.

Как CSS отвечает за внешний оформление веб-ресурса

C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ей определяют зрительное представление HTML-элементов. Механизм разделяет дизайн от структуры документа.

Без стилей все сайты отображаются одинаково. Браузер показывает текст чёрным тоном на белом подложке. Заголовки получают обычные размеры. CSS позволяет поменять каждый параметр внешнего оформления.

Стили можно присоединить тремя методами. Внешний документ связывается с HTML-документом посредством метку link. Внутренние стили помещаются в теге style. Инлайновые стили прописываются в параметре элемента.

Каскадность обозначает очерёдность использования директив. Inline стили имеют максимальный приоритет. Внутренние стили замещают внешние. Браузер задействует самое точное директиву к каждому тегу.

CSS регулирует всеми зрительными характеристиками. Разработчики задают оттенки фона и текста. Стили корректируют величины, поля и рамки контейнеров. Современный 7К казино применяет анимации и переходы для генерации динамических результатов.

Селекторы, атрибуты и значения в CSS

Директива CSS складывается из трёх частей. Селектор определяет элемент для оформления. Атрибут задаёт параметр стилизации. Параметр устанавливает точный значение.

Селекторы определяют компоненты по разнообразным критериям. Селектор элемента применяет стили ко всем компонентам конкретного класса. Селектор класса функционирует с свойством class. Селектор идентификатора отбирает единственный тег по свойству id.

Комбинированные селекторы формируют более точные правила. Селектор потомка отбирает вложенные теги. Селектор дочернего элемента работает только с прямыми потомками. Псевдоклассы назначают стили при определённых ситуациях.

Атрибуты определяют различные стороны стилизации. Параметры color и background-color управляют цветовой палитрой. Атрибуты width и height определяют величины. Параметры margin и padding управляют поля.

Параметры записываются в различных вариантах. Оттенки определяются в шестнадцатеричном виде, RGB или названиями. Размеры определяются в пикселях, процентах или пропорциональных единицах. Корректное использование селекторов способствует казино 7к продуктивно управлять оформлением большого количества компонентов.

Управление с тонами, гарнитурами и интервалами

Цветовое дизайн формирует визуальную настроение страницы. Атрибут color меняет цвет содержимого. Параметр background-color устанавливает подложку блока. Оттенки указываются несколькими способами: именами, шестнадцатеричными записями или значениями RGB.

Шестнадцатеричный формат открывается с знака диеза. Код складывается из шести символов, обозначающих красный, зелёный и синий компоненты. Формат RGB задействует числовые величины от 0 до 255 для каждого цвета. Тип RGBA включает параметр прозрачности.

Шрифтовое оформление воздействует на удобочитаемость контента. Атрибут font-family задаёт семейство шрифта. Свойство font-size устанавливает размер надписи. Атрибут font-weight управляет жирность начертания. Атрибут line-height задаёт межстрочный интервал.

Встроенные шрифты присутствуют на всех платформах. Внешние гарнитуры скачиваются с сторонних хостов. Сервис Google Fonts даёт свободную подборку шрифтов. Специалисты перечисляют несколько гарнитур в очерёдности предпочтения.

Интервалы формируют место около компонентов. Параметр margin формирует внешние поля между контейнерами. Параметр padding генерирует внутренние интервалы от краёв до наполнения. Интервалы можно устанавливать для каждой грани индивидуально или единым значением сразу для всех граней. Корректное задействование 7k casino улучшает графическую структуру и усвоение информации.

Блочная модель и позиционирование элементов

Блочная концепция характеризует архитектуру каждого HTML-элемента. Концепция формируется из четырёх областей: содержимого, внутреннего поля, границы и внешнего интервала. Понимание этой идеи важно для корректного контроля размерами.

Секция наполнения включает текст и картинки. Внутренний поле padding генерирует область между наполнением и границей. Обводка border окружает элемент видимой чертой. Наружный отступ margin формирует интервал до соседних блоков.

Атрибут box-sizing модифицирует расчёт размеров. Параметр content-box включает только контент. Значение border-box включает padding и border в общую ширину.

Параметр display устанавливает тип визуализации. Блочные блоки используют всю свободную ширину. Инлайновые компоненты размещаются в одной ряду. Вариант inline-block сочетает особенности обоих типов.

Атрибут position контролирует позиционированием. Вариант relative смещает блок относительно начального позиции. Absolute размещает элемент относительно вышестоящего элемента. Актуальный 7К казино применяет Flexbox и Grid для создания многоуровневых компоновок.

Отзывчивая разработка для разных аппаратов

Гибкая верстка обеспечивает корректное отображение сайта на всех экранах. Посетители посещают на сайты с ПК, планшетов и телефонов. Макет обязан подстраиваться под величину экрана самостоятельно.

Медиазапросы используют стили в зависимости от свойств устройства. Правило @media контролирует ширину дисплея и другие свойства. Разработчики создают отдельные комплекты стилей для разнообразных интервалов габаритов.

Метод mobile-first начинает создание с редакции для телефонов. Начальные стили описывают оформление для компактных дисплеев. Медиазапросы добавляют усложнения для широких экранов.

Гибкие сетки используют пропорциональные единицы измерения. Ширина контейнеров задаётся в процентах вместо постоянных пикселей. Flexbox и Grid создают адаптивные макеты без сложных расчётов.

Картинки требуют повышенного внимания при оптимизации. Свойство max-width со параметром 100% предотвращает выход картинок за пределы элемента. Атрибут srcset скачивает картинки разного качества. Правильная реализация 7k casino повышает пользовательский восприятие на всех категориях аппаратов.

Распространённые недочёты стартующих при взаимодействии с HTML и CSS

Новички разработчики допускают типичные ошибки при создании веб-страниц. Знание типичных недочётов помогает избежать их в собственных разработках. Исправление недочётов на начальных фазах экономит время и повышает качество скрипта.

Основные недочёты при взаимодействии с разметкой и стилями:

  • Незавершённые метки разрушают структуру документа и ведут к неправильному отображению
  • Применение deprecated элементов вместо новых семантических компонентов
  • Недостаток описательного текста для картинок снижает доступность содержимого
  • Инлайновые стили в HTML усложняют сопровождение и модификацию оформления
  • Неправильная иерархия элементов создаёт проблемы в организации
  • Излишнее применение идентификаторов вместо классов затрудняет вторичное использование стилей

Недочёты с CSS также возникают постоянно. Начинающие забывают прописывать единицы расчёта для цифровых параметров. Слишком специфичные селекторы затрудняют переопределение стилей. Отсутствие обнуления стилей браузера вызывает отличия в отображении на разнообразных платформах.

Игнорирование кроссбраузерной совместимости приводит к ошибкам. Веб-страница может отлично смотреться в одном обозревателе и неправильно в втором. Верификация скрипта посредством специализированные инструменты выявляет синтаксические ошибки. Постоянная проверка способствует казино 7к обеспечивать отличное стандарт разработки и соответствие нормам.

Leave a Reply

Your email address will not be published. Required fields are marked *